FENSA Approved
It can be a challenge to select the best double-glazing business. You need to take into account not only your budget and design preferences, but also if they are FENSA-approved. This is a government scheme that ensures the work they do is in compliance with. It also helps homeowners to have their windows inspected and approved.
FENSA is the acronym for Fenestration Self-Assessment Scheme. It was established in April 2002 to address changes in building regulations for replacement windows, roof lights and doors. Six bodies oversee and Double Glazed Window Repairs Near Me allow members with the ability to self-certify. Choose an FENSA approved installer to be sure that your installation is in compliance with local building regulations, and will be registered at your council.
A FENSA approved installer will offer the warranty of between five and ten years and an insurance-backed guarantee for their products. This can be helpful should you decide to sell your home in the future. It's an excellent idea to request an original copy of their FENSA certificate as proof that the installation is up to standards.

Insurance
When choosing double glazing contractors near me, it's important to take into account their insurance policies. They must be insured for public liability and any damages caused through their work. They should also provide a comprehensive warranty on their products and work.
Double glazed windows are designed to reduce energy bills and increase the security of homes. They are constructed of two panes that are hermetically sealed and separated by the spacer. The gap is filled with an insulation gas such as argon. They also feature thermo break to minimize condensation and heat loss. Double-glazed windows are more efficient in energy use than single-paned windows and can save homeowners as much as PS235 on their annual electricity bills.
